Description
The Alabaster Lord is a haunting figure, a remnant of an ancient civilization awakened by the impact of a long-fallen meteor. With skin resembling polished stone and a mesmerizing mane of shimmering hair, this tall and slender entity serves as both a guardian and a punishment for those who dare to trespass on sacred grounds. It is said that they embody the tumultuous power of both the cosmos and the shores, moving with an eerie grace as they defend their territory.
Size | Medium |
Type | Elemental |
CR | 5 |
XP | 1800 |
Languages | Common, Celestial |
Armor Class | 15 |
HP Range | 45 - 60 (Avg: 53) |
Damage Vulnerabilities | None |
Damage Resistances | None |
Damage Immunities | None |
Condition Immunities | None |
Abyssal Lament
The haunting wails of the Alabaster Lord echo across the shore, compelling nearby creatures to make a DC 14 Wisdom saving throw. On a failed save, a creature is frightened for 1 minute. The creature can repeat the saving throw at the end of each of its turns, ending the effect on itself on a success.
Meteor Strike
The Alabaster Lord channels the energy of the ancient meteor, unleashing a radiant bolt of cosmic energy. Each creature in a 30-foot line must make a DC 15 Dexterity saving throw, taking 3d10 radiant damage on a failed save or half as much on a successful one.
Stone Shield
The Alabaster Lord can encase itself in a protective layer of stone for 1 minute, gaining +2 to AC and resistance to bludgeoning, piercing, and slashing damage until the end of its next turn.
